The Giant Eyeball in Dallas, TX is a unique cultural landmark that offers visitors a one-of-a-kind experience in the heart of downtown Dallas. This iconic attraction serves as a neighborhood gathering place and luxury boutique hotel, attracting design lovers, art enthusiasts, and those seeking the uncommon.
With 160 well-appointed rooms, suites, and penthouses, the Giant Eyeball provides a quiet retreat in the midst of urban vibrancy. Guests can enjoy award-winning spa treatments, dining options, and a range of amenities that cater to both leisure and business travelers.
Generated from the website